The Affidavit of Forgery form is essential for individuals in Queens who need to report unauthorized signatures or endorsements on checks. This legal document allows users to formally declare that a specific check was not signed or endorsed by them, asserting that the signature is a forgery. The form requires detailed information, including the check number, the bank's name, and the amount of the check, alongside personal identification details. Users must complete fields regarding the forger's name and the bank's actions related to the transaction.
